Fortem Solutions are currently recruiting for a 'Working' Electrical Qualifying Supervisor to join our Cambridge Housing Society contract, of which the office is based in Histon. Please note, this will be a 'Working' Supervisor role, so we are looking for someone who is looking to take the next step towards becoming a Supervisor, whilst still completing Electrical trade jobs. This is a great opportunity for someone who is looking to get a sample of Supervision.
Our contract with Cambridge Housing Society is a long term partnership with houses covering the whole of Cambridgeshire, from Wisbech down to Haverhill, although primarily situated in central Cambridge. There are nearly 3,000 properties, mostly houses and flats, and we will be looking after their Repairs, Voids, Cyclical Works and Planned workstreams.
As our 'Working' Electrical Supervisor you will ensure that Fortem complies with all electrical regulations and maintains its registration as an NICEIC approved electrical contractor. You will have day to day responsibility for the safety, technical standard and quality of all categories of electrical work including installation, certification of works, repairs and alterations carried out under the scope of the contract.

Fortem are Social Housing property experts. It is our sole focus, and the only sector we have worked in since inception in 2002. We successfully deliver works across three workstreams - Repairs & Maintenance, Capital Works and Retrofit. Our mission is to raise the bar in Social Housing and help our clients provide safe, warm and decent homes for people to live in - because Every Home Matters.
We are a Willmott Dixon Group Company. As such, we benefit from the credibility and recognition associated with a large and long-established brand - whilst as a standalone business within the Group, we maintain the flexibility to adapt our services to meet the unique challenges of the social housing marketplace.
